The Defense Logistics Agency awarded a delivery order under contract SPE4AX-16-D-9010 to ASRC Federal Facilities Logistics, CAGE 79343, for the delivery of 2.000 pounds of lubricant, antisize, identified by NSN 9150001050270, at a total price of $103.26. The order was issued on July 16, 2026, with a required delivery date of August 5, 2026, to Fort Irwin, California, under FOB destination terms, meaning title transfers upon arrival at the delivery point. The contract specifies that shipment must occur via the fastest traceable means, explicitly prohibiting parcel post, and all packaging must be clearly marked with the Transportation Control Number W80WKN61980019, Required Delivery Date 213, and the destination address, along with applicable NSN and CAGE codes including U4535, 5W425, and U2215. The contractor is recognized as a Small Disadvantaged Woman-Owned Business, triggering obligations under FAR 52.219-10 for small business subcontracting reporting. Payment will be processed by the Defense Finance and Accounting Service in Columbus, Ohio, and invoices must adhere to DFARS 252.232-7003, submitted by mail. Acceptance occurs at the delivery location, overseen by the government representative Amanda Parker, with inspection based solely on conformance to contract terms without reference to external standards. The contract incorporates all terms from its underlying basic delivery order contract and is subject to the Defense Priorities and Allocations System under 15 CFR 700. No options, modifications, or additional clauses beyond those referenced are detailed, and no barcoding standards, military packaging specifications, or formal evaluation factors are stipulated in the documentation.
